NCT ID: NCT04876950 Not yet recruiting - Surgery Clinical Trials

Post Discharge After Surgery Virtual Care With Remote Automated Monitoring Technology (PVC-RAM) -2 Trial

PVC-RAM-2
Start date: June 2024
Phase: N/A
Study type: Interventional

The Post discharge after surgery Virtual Care with Remote Automated Monitoring technology (PVC-RAM)-2 Trial is a multicentre, parallel group, superiority, randomized controlled trial to determine the effect of virtual care with remote automated monitoring (RAM) technology compared to standard care on acute-hospital care during the 30-day follow up after randomization, in adults who have undergone semi-urgent (e.g., oncology), urgent (e.g., hip fracture), or emergency (e.g., ruptured abdominal aortic aneurysm) surgery. Secondary outcomes at 30 days after randomization include 1) hospital re-admission; 2) emergency department visit; 3) medication error detection; 4) medication error correction; and 5) surgical site infection. Additional secondary outcomes are pain of any severity, and moderate-to-severe pain assessed at 7, 15, and 30 days. We will also assess optimal management of long-term health by evaluating among patients with atherosclerotic disease whether patients are taking classes of efficacious medications at 30 days.

NCT ID: NCT04876404 Recruiting - Parkinson Disease Clinical Trials

Somatotopy in Parkinson's Disease

Start date: January 25, 2021
Phase:
Study type: Observational

This study aims to assess changes in connections within the brain in Parkinson's disease (PD). We will invite up to 10 people with PD to participate in this study and complete several brain scans using PET (Positron Emission Tomography) and fMRI (functional Magnetic Resonance Imaging) on the Hybrid PET/MRI scanner. We will also invite 10 participants without PD to complete the same scans for comparison. "Somatotopy" refers to how areas of the brain are organized according to the body part they affect. The striatum is the brain region that coordinates complex thinking and movement. Plasticity refers to changes in connections within the brain, which can happen to make up for changes that are related to PD. In this study we will use PET and fMRI imaging together to investigate changes in the striatum in people affected by Parkinson's disease. The hybrid PET/MR scanner allows us to perform simultaneous PET and MRI measurements to investigate this.

NCT ID: NCT04876391 Completed - Clinical trials for Hidradenitis Suppurativa

A Study Investigating Long-term Treatment With Spesolimab in People With a Skin Disease Called Hidradenitis Suppurativa Who Completed a Previous Clinical Trial

Start date: July 27, 2021
Phase: Phase 2
Study type: Interventional

This study is open to adults with hidradenitis suppurativa who took part in a previous clinical study of a medicine called spesolimab. Participants who completed treatment can join this study. The purpose of this study is to find out how safe spesolimab is and whether it helps people with hidradenitis suppurativa in the long-term. Participants are in this study for about 2 years and 4 months. For 2 years, participants visit the study site every 2 weeks to get spesolimab injections under the skin. At study visits, doctors check the severity of participants' hidradenitis suppurativa and collect information on any health problems of the participants.

NCT ID: NCT04876365 Completed - Hemophilia A Clinical Trials

A Study in Children, Teenagers and Adults With Severe Hemophilia A Who Switched From Other Factor VIII Treatments to Adynovate

Start date: November 30, 2021
Phase:
Study type: Observational

The main aims of the study are to assess the safety profile of Adynovate as well as how well people respond to the preventive treatment with Adynovate. This study is about reviewing and collecting data of the participants before and after the switch to Adynovate that are already available. No new information will be collected during this study. The total time for data collection in the study will be approximately 72 months (36 months before and 36 months after switching to Adynovate). Participants will not receive Adynovate as part of this study. As participants are not treated in this study, they do not need to visit their doctor in addition to their normal visits.

NCT ID: NCT04876079 Completed - Type 1 Diabetes Clinical Trials

Prevention of Mild-to-moderate Hypoglycemia in Type 1 Diabetes

REVERSIBLE
Start date: June 1, 2021
Phase: N/A
Study type: Interventional

According to guidelines, when a mild-to-moderate hypoglycemia occurs (capillary blood glucose < 4.0 mmol/L), 15-20g of rapidly absorbed carbohydrates should be ingested. Patients should re-test and re-ingest 15-20g carbohydrates every 15 minutes until they recover from hypoglycemia. These recommendations were principally based on two studies conducted in the 80s before the introduction of intensive insulin therapy. In practice, only 32-50% of patients follow the current guidelines. In addition, recent studies suggest that under current intensive insulin therapies, an initial correction with 15g of oral glucose may be insufficient to rapidly correct mild-to-moderate hypoglycemia. With the development and increasing usage of newer glucose monitoring technologies, the community is witnessing a shift in hypoglycemia management, from a reactive to a proactive approach (e.g., prevent imminent episodes rather than treating established episodes).

NCT ID: NCT04875572 Completed - Anxiety Clinical Trials

Associations Between Analgesia Nociception Index and Preoperative Anxiety

PANIC
Start date: February 17, 2021
Phase: N/A
Study type: Interventional

The management and prediction of pain is one of the most crucial jobs for anesthetists. It has been shown that a patient's ability to remain calm during stressful situations is related to their post-surgical pain scores. The MetroDoloris Analgesia Nociception Index (ANI) monitor is a heart-rate monitor that provides us with a number which reflects a patient's state of relaxation (or parasympathetic tone). For this reason, the investigators are testing whether ANI can be used as a metric for perioperative anxiety, and a predictive tool for pain after c-sections.
